Hatch is seeking a Senior Electrical Engineer to join our team, known for delivering technically robust and innovative solutions across complex mining, energy, and infrastructure projects. In this role, you will apply your deep electrical engineering expertise to lead the development of high-quality designs and studies, contributing to projects that span the full lifecycle, from early-stage concept and feasibility through to detailed design, construction, and commissioning. This is an opportunity for a technically solid engineer who enjoys both hands‑on delivery and influencing broader project outcomes. You will play a key role within multidisciplinary teams, providing trusted technical input while also mentoring and developing junior engineers, helping to build capability and maintain Hatch’s high standards of engineering excellence.
Key Focus Areas
- Lead the development of electrical designs, studies, and calculations from concept through to detailed design
- Provide technical oversight and guidance during engineering, procurement, construction, and commissioning phases
- Contribute to project estimates, schedules, and discipline inputs within multi‑disciplinary teams
- Support and participate in formal design and engineering review processes
- Provide on‑site technical support during construction and commissioning activities
- Act as a technical mentor, coaching and supporting the development of junior engineers
About You
You hold a degree in Electrical Engineering and bring 5+ years’ relevant experience, ideally with CPEng (or working towards). You have strong technical depth in power systems and electrical design within mining, energy, infrastructure, or similar heavy industry environments, including experience performing electrical studies such as load flow, arc flash, and protection grading using tools like ETAP, SKM PTW or PowerCAD. You are confident leading technical work, engaging with stakeholders, and communicating complex information clearly. You also take a proactive approach to mentoring and developing others, contributing to a strong and capable engineering team.
